Output 26f601482e589189d4c58258a72d268eb6cfcbeedf93400bb77eb8ec566cef86:247

value
6561
script pubkey
OP_0 OP_PUSHBYTES_20 b35ddde81a077ac003cd93c53e0b162ffa91d4b7
address
bc1qkdwam6q6qaavqq7dj0znuzck9lafr49h5ppnrm
transaction
26f601482e589189d4c58258a72d268eb6cfcbeedf93400bb77eb8ec566cef86
spent
true